Questions about La Frontera Center

What type of facility is La Frontera Center?
La Frontera Center is a Mental Health Treatment facility operated by Private non-profit organization in Tucson, Arizona. Its SAMHSA record documents two documented care modalities.
Does La Frontera Center offer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T)?
MAT is not listed on the current record. Confirm with the facility.
What payment and insurance does La Frontera Center accept?
La Frontera Center accepts: Medicaid, private insurance, a sliding-fee scale, payment assistance; broad payment access.
